Market Overview

The GCC (Gulf Cooperation Council) GRP (Glass Reinforced Plastic) pipe market is a vital segment of the construction and infrastructure industry in the Gulf region. GRP pipes, also known as fiberglass reinforced plastic pipes, are widely used for various applications, including water supply, sewage systems, oil and gas pipelines, and industrial processes. The GCC region, comprising countries such as Saudi Arabia, the United Arab Emirates, Qatar, Oman, Bahrain, and Kuwait, has witnessed significant infrastructure development and urbanization in recent years, driving the demand for GRP pipes.

Meaning

GRP pipes are composite materials made from reinforced plastic fibers embedded in a polymer matrix. These pipes offer numerous advantages, including corrosion resistance, high strength-to-weight ratio, durability, and low maintenance requirements. They are suitable for both aboveground and underground installations and are favored for applications requiring resistance to chemicals, temperature extremes, and environmental degradation. The GCC GRP pipe market encompasses the production, distribution, and installation of these pipes across various sectors, contributing to the region’s infrastructure development and economic growth.

Key Market Insights

  • Infrastructure Development: The GCC region has witnessed substantial investments in infrastructure projects, including water supply networks, sewage systems, and oil and gas pipelines. GRP pipes are favored for their durability and longevity, making them a preferred choice for such projects.
  • Water and Wastewater Management: The demand for GRP pipes in water and wastewater applications is driven by the need for reliable and efficient conveyance systems. Growing populations, urbanization, and industrialization have increased the pressure on water resources, necessitating investments in water infrastructure.
  • Oil and Gas Industry: GRP pipes find applications in the oil and gas sector for the transportation of corrosive fluids and gases. The GCC region’s rich hydrocarbon reserves and ongoing exploration and production activities create opportunities for the use of GRP pipes in pipelines and offshore installations.
  • Industrial Applications: GRP pipes are used in various industrial processes, including chemical processing, desalination plants, power generation, and mining. Their resistance to corrosion, abrasion, and chemical attack makes them suitable for harsh operating environments.

Market Drivers

  • Infrastructure Investments: Government-led initiatives and private sector investments in infrastructure projects drive the demand for GRP pipes in the GCC region. Mega projects such as urban developments, transportation networks, and utilities expansion provide opportunities for GRP pipe manufacturers and suppliers.
  • Water Scarcity: The GCC countries face challenges related to water scarcity and the need for efficient water management solutions. GRP pipes are favored for water transmission and distribution due to their corrosion resistance, leak-free joints, and long service life, driving demand in the water sector.
  • Corrosion Resistance: GRP pipes offer superior corrosion resistance compared to traditional materials like steel and concrete. In corrosive soil conditions or environments with aggressive chemicals, GRP pipes provide a cost-effective and durable solution, driving their adoption in various applications.
  • Ease of Installation: The lightweight nature of GRP pipes makes them easier and faster to install compared to traditional materials. This results in cost savings in terms of labor, equipment, and installation time, making GRP pipes a preferred choice for contractors and project developers.

Market Restraints

  • Raw Material Costs: Fluctuations in raw material prices, such as resin and fiberglass, impact the production costs of GRP pipes. Price volatility can affect profit margins for manufacturers and suppliers, necessitating effective cost management strategies.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Compliance with regulatory standards and specifications is essential for GRP pipe manufacturers to ensure product quality and performance. Meeting stringent requirements for testing, certification, and quality control adds to production costs and administrative burdens.
  • Competition from Alternative Materials: GRP pipes face competition from alternative materials such as ductile iron, PVC, HDPE, and concrete. Each material has its advantages and disadvantages, and the choice depends on factors such as project requirements, cost considerations, and performance criteria.
  • Project Delays: Delays in infrastructure projects due to regulatory approvals, funding constraints, or geopolitical factors can impact the demand for GRP pipes. Uncertainties in project timelines and budgets may lead to fluctuations in market demand and sales volumes.

Market Opportunities

  • Smart Water Management: The adoption of smart technologies for water management presents opportunities for the integration of GRP pipes with sensors, monitoring systems, and data analytics. Smart water networks enable real-time monitoring, leakage detection, and optimization of water distribution systems.
  • Renewable Energy Infrastructure: The GCC region’s focus on renewable energy sources such as solar and wind power creates opportunities for GRP pipes in energy infrastructure projects. GRP pipes are used for the construction of cooling water systems, desalination plants, and piping networks in renewable energy facilities.
  • Infrastructure Rehabilitation: The aging infrastructure in the GCC countries requires rehabilitation and replacement to maintain functionality and serviceability. GRP pipes offer a cost-effective solution for pipeline rehabilitation, providing structural integrity and corrosion resistance without the need for extensive excavation.
  • Desalination Projects: Desalination plants are essential for addressing water scarcity in the GCC region. GRP pipes are widely used in desalination projects for seawater intake and brine discharge, offering resistance to corrosion, abrasion, and marine growth.

Regional Analysis

  • Saudi Arabia: The largest economy in the GCC, Saudi Arabia, is a key market for GRP pipes, driven by infrastructure projects, water management initiatives, and industrial developments.
  • United Arab Emirates: The UAE’s construction boom, driven by urbanization and mega projects like Expo 2020 Dubai, fuels demand for GRP pipes in water supply, sewerage, and irrigation systems.
  • Qatar: Qatar’s investments in infrastructure and preparations for the FIFA World Cup 2022 drive demand for GRP pipes in stadium construction, transportation networks, and utilities expansion.
  • Oman: Oman’s focus on diversifying its economy and developing infrastructure projects like ports, airports, and industrial zones creates opportunities for GRP pipe manufacturers and suppliers.
  • Bahrain: Bahrain’s strategic location as a financial hub and its investments in tourism and real estate drive demand for GRP pipes in construction and infrastructure projects.
  • Kuwait: Kuwait’s development plans, including the Kuwait Vision 2035 and New Kuwait 2035, provide opportunities for GRP pipes in infrastructure development, oil and gas projects, and industrial expansion.

Segmentation

The GCC GRP pipe market can be segmented based on various factors such as application, diameter, and resin type:

  • Application: Water supply, sewerage and drainage, oil and gas, industrial processes, irrigation, and others.
  • Diameter: Small diameter (< 24 inches), medium diameter (24โ€“64 inches), and large diameter (> 64 inches).
  • Resin Type: Polyester, epoxy, vinylester, and others.

Segmentation provides insights into market trends, customer preferences, and demand dynamics, enabling companies to tailor their products and services to specific market segments.

Category-wise Insights

  • Water Supply: GRP pipes are widely used for water transmission and distribution networks due to their corrosion resistance, leak-free joints, and long service life.
  • Sewerage and Drainage: GRP pipes are favored for sewerage and drainage applications due to their resistance to abrasion, chemical attack, and root intrusion.
  • Oil and Gas Pipelines: GRP pipes find applications in oil and gas pipelines for their corrosion resistance, low maintenance requirements, and long-term performance.
  • Industrial Processes: GRP pipes are used in various industrial processes such as chemical processing, desalination, power generation, and mining for their durability and reliability.
  • Irrigation: GRP pipes are suitable for irrigation systems due to their resistance to corrosion, UV degradation, and hydraulic efficiency.

Key Benefits for Industry Participants and Stakeholders

  • Durability: GRP pipes offer long-term durability, with a service life of 50 years or more, reducing the need for frequent replacements and maintenance.
  • Corrosion Resistance: GRP pipes are resistant to corrosion, rust, and chemical attack, making them suitable for harsh environments and corrosive fluids.
  • Lightweight: GRP pipes are lightweight compared to traditional materials like steel and concrete, facilitating easier handling, transportation, and installation.
  • Low Maintenance: GRP pipes require minimal maintenance and repair, resulting in cost savings over the lifecycle of the infrastructure.
  • Environmental Benefits: GRP pipes are environmentally friendly, with low carbon footprint and energy consumption during production and operation.

SWOT Analysis

  • Strengths: Corrosion resistance, durability, lightweight, low maintenance, and environmental sustainability.
  • Weaknesses: Initial cost, susceptibility to impact damage, and limited availability of large diameters.
  • Opportunities: Infrastructure investments, water scarcity solutions, renewable energy projects, and technological advancements.
  • Threats: Competition from alternative materials, raw material price fluctuations, regulatory changes, and geopolitical risks.
